Project Analyst – Join the EMEA IT Team at GESAbout the RoleAn excellent opportunity has arisen for a Project Analyst to join the EMEA IT Applications team at Global Experience Specialists (GES). This role plays a key part in supporting the successful delivery of application-related projects and initiatives across the EMEA region.The ideal candidate will be experienced in coordinating IT or business systems projects, with a strong grasp of both technical and functional requirements. You will work closely with global stakeholders, helping translate business needs into actionable plans, while providing essential structure, documentation, and progress tracking throughout each project’s lifecycle.This is a varied and dynamic position that combines business analysis, project coordination, and stakeholder communication — ideal for a professional who thrives in a collaborative, fast-paced, and flexible environment.Key ResponsibilitiesProject Coordination:Support the planning, execution, and monitoring of application projects from initiation through to completion.Business Analysis:Collaborate with business and IT stakeholders to gather and document requirements, translating them into functional specifications.Cross-Functional Collaboration:Work across multiple departments, both in the UK and internationally, to ensure timely and effective delivery of project components.Project Planning:Maintain detailed project plans, track tasks, manage timelines, and help coordinate resources.Risk Management:Identify potential risks or blockers, develop mitigation strategies, and monitor progress.Stakeholder Communication:Act as a central point of contact for project updates, status reporting, and alignment between teams.Documentation:Prepare and maintain accurate records, reports, and supporting materials including user guides, meeting minutes, and training documents.Skills & ExperienceA Bachelor’s degree in a relevant field or equivalent professional experience.Solid understanding of both Agile and Waterfall project delivery methodologies.Experience supporting or coordinating IT, application, or systems projects.Familiarity with SQL and data analysis is preferred.Understanding of business systems, particularly financial or warehouse ERP platforms (e.g., Sage X3), is advantageous.Excellent written and verbal communication skills with the ability to collaborate across departments and time zones.Strong organisational skills, attention to detail, and ability to manage multiple workstreams effectively.Why Join GES?Impactful Work:Play a key role in supporting high-value digital and systems initiatives across the EMEA region.Professional Growth:Gain exposure to a broad range of business applications, project types, and global teams.Supportive Culture:Join a collaborative IT environment where your contributions are recognised and your development is supported.Competitive Benefits:Be part of a company that values its employees and rewards success.About GESAt Global Experience Specialists (GES), we help brands connect with audiences through live events, exhibitions, and cutting-edge digital experiences.
